About the role An exciting opportunity has arisen within Police Scotland to be part of the Information Disclosure Team. We are looking for a leader to join the team who will play a key part in supporting our team of Disclosure Officers in all matters covering Subject Access, Freedom of Information and Protection of Vulnerable Groups. This role is about making sure requests are handled lawfully, on time, and in a clear and helpful way. You will support, mentor and guide staff, checking the quality of responses, and acting as a point of contact for more the complex or sensitive cases. You will also help improve how the service works day to day. What youll be doing Supervising and supporting staff who process FOI, Subject Access requests and oversee the PVG process. Making sure requests meet legal requirements and deadlines and reviewing and signing off responses before they are sent Handling complex, high-risk, or sensitive cases Giving advice to colleagues across the organisation about information rights Helping to improve processes, templates, and guidance Supporting training and development within the team You will contact our regulators where necessary. What were looking for Experience of working with Freedom of Information, Subject Access legislation or PVG legislation is essential Experience supervising staff or leading work (formal management experience is helpful but not essential) Strong written communication skills and attention to detail Ability to manage workloads, deadlines, and competing priorities Confidence in making decisions and explaining them clearly A calm and professional approach, especially with sensitive information Why work with us A supportive team and a role where your expertise really matters Opportunities to develop leadership and specialist knowledge Why join us?
